The cooking process explained

Making Fried Potatoes, Onions, and Smoked Polish Sausage is straightforward, requiring just a few simple steps. Start by heating oil or butter in a skillet, then add the diced potatoes and allow them to cook until they’re golden and crispy. Next, stir in the onions and let them soften before adding the sliced sausage. Finally, season to taste and serve hot. It’s a dish that comes together in less than an hour, making it ideal for those busy evenings!

Gather these items

Here’s what you’ll need to make this delicious dish:

  • 3–4 potatoes, peeled and diced
  • 1 smoked Polish sausage, sliced
  • 1 small onion, chopped
  • 2–3 tbsp oil or butter
  • Salt and black pepper
  • Optional: paprika or garlic powder for extra flavor

Feel free to swap in other types of sausage or even add bell peppers for a color boost.
